    “Hahahaha!”

    It was an utterly ridiculous sound.

    Lazy Flame Dragon laughed loudly while banging on the war chariot’s roof.

    He paid no mind to the fact that Radiant Demon Wing seniors were riding inside.

    Even his legs, which were propped up casually, were swinging wildly, making for a comical sight.

    He got angry easily, and he enjoyed himself just as intensely.

    He was a short-lived talent dealing with life differently than Jeong Yeon-shin.

    He was utterly honest with his emotions. He had been fierce when striking down prodigies at the Dragon Phoenix Gathering, and when he was in a good mood, he laughed without restraint.

    Everyone present knew about the Scorching Divine Meridian’s lifespan. No one tried to stop him.

    Only Baek Mi-ryeo’s irritated voice leaked from inside the carriage, saying “Be quiet, unnamed fool.”

    “What’s so funny?”

    Hyeon Won-chang asked in confusion. The corners of his mouth turned slightly downward. He seemed somewhat displeased.

    The boy’s lips curved into a small arc.

    “He’s right. Even if it was a slip of the tongue, it was still inappropriate.”

    Jeong Yeon-shin tried to perform an apologetic martial salute while continuing to walk.

    Ma Yeon-jeok’s condition wasn’t widely known.

    If Little Sword Queen had approached without knowing, then Jeong Yeon-shin had committed rudeness.

    Moreover, he had just been warned to be cautious with his energy. He didn’t want to start a fight unnecessarily.

    That’s when it happened.

    Qu Su-yu’s briefly frozen lips relaxed upward. The corners of her mouth became slightly puffy.

    Then meaningless laughter flowed out creating a strange impression. It was a face that looked gentle yet hard to read her true thoughts.

    “It seems the former Divine Sword Group Leader’s condition is quite serious.”

    She moved her lips with a smiling face.

    “Lightning… Young Master Jeong? Is that right? I’ve been rude. I beg your forgiveness.”

    “…”

    “Ah, I wasn’t trying to probe maliciously. I truly wanted to pay respects to the former leader. Wouldn’t it be the greatest honor for a martial artist to receive words of wisdom from one who killed the peerless Blood Flame Sect Leader?”

    “You weren’t probing?”

    “If it’s not possible then that can’t be helped… As a righteous path warrior of the murim, I’ll have to find my own role.”

    It was a gentle voice. Her voice mixed with the summer wind approached softly.

    Little Sword Queen Qu Su-yu raised her clasped hands. Her long flowing hair scattered on both sides of her shoulders.

    It was a martial salute toward Jeong Yeon-shin. Rather, she had taken the initiative to apologize first.

    ‘Little Sword Queen. She seems like an unusual person.’

    Jeong Yeon-shin silently returned the martial salute. She was a type of person he hadn’t encountered before.

    Her bearing had the freedom that Azure Qilin Namgung Se-jin had spoken of.

    She carried herself freely without particularly minding others’ gazes, and when she felt she had crossed a line she apologized sincerely.

    Though he heard she was the Diancang Sect’s next sect leader, she was different from other family heirs.

    ‘Freedom always comes with a price.’

    That’s how Azure Qilin had been. He couldn’t easily step down from his position as heir.

    Thinking back now, Jeong Yeon-shin thought it was because he was wary of his family taking the wrong path.

    It could be seen in his attitude of helping Namgung Hwa-shin leave and coldly treating his tyrannical sister.

    As a great hero, he paradoxically couldn’t abandon his authority.

    The boy slowly parted his lips.

    “What do you mean by your own role?”

    “Ah.”

    Qu Su-yu’s smile faded slightly.

    “Do you perhaps know something of the current murim situation?”

    “I don’t.”

    Jeong Yeon-shin answered briefly. He had only travelled between Kuizhou and the Tang Clan.

    After several battles his mind had been focused on his grandfather’s internal injuries.

    He wanted to hear everything she knew. He hadn’t had the chance to catch up on the news from the Central Plains.

    “I see.”

    Qu Su-yu smiled without pretense.

    She looked somewhat dazed, but her attention seemed focused on the three carriages rather than Jeong Yeon-shin.

    She seemed quite eager to meet former Divine Sword Group Leader Ma Yeon-jeok.

    She opened her mouth very slowly.

    “Hmm… But, I think you must have heard about the formation of the Martial Alliance.”

    “Yes, I know of it.”

    “The Zhuge family of Hanzhong gathered opinions. Seven great prestigious families and dozens of sects claiming to be orthodox paths formed an alliance. I hear invitations were sent even to the Nine Sects including my sect.”

    “And?”

    “The Thirteen Evil Sects and other demonic paths are reacting sensitively. To them it must look like establishing a second Desolate Fortress. And just then… rumors spread that the battle between Desolate Fortress’s purple-rank and the Blood Flame Sect Leader ended nearly in mutual destruction.”

    “…”

    “It’s a shocking incident, but isn’t it an opportunity to cut down the major forces of hostile factions? Especially with word that there’s another peerless purple-rank master bedridden…”

    Her dreamy eyes scanned each of the three war carriages in turn. As if trying to pierce through to see the Elder Council Leader’s sickbed.

    Then meeting Jeong Yeon-shin’s eyes, she smiled brightly.

    Little Sword Queen was truly a strange person. She clearly carried the righteousness of the Nine Sects throughout her body.

    She appeared free-spirited and simple, even a bit scatterbrained, but her final words and gaze always touched on something deadly.

    Swoosh!

    In that moment, Jeong Yeon-shin sensed Hyeon Won-chang adjusting his grip on his sword.

    Namgung Hwa-shin also tried to maintain his composure, but he couldn’t hide the powerful energy rising within him.

    As White Qilin and an acquaintance, he still hadn’t let down his guard.

    “You’re saying there are definitely those aiming for our return journey.”

    The boy didn’t bother hiding his unease. Little Sword Queen Qu Su-yu gently nodded.

    That’s when it happened.

    The person beside her who considered Little Sword Queen his superior seemed irritated by Jeong Yeon-shin’s attitude.

    “I am Xie Dao-ling of the Diancang Sect.”

    The man wearing blue martial clothes and carrying one sword performed a brief salute.

    Piercing Sun Sword Xie Dao-ling.

    He was famous as a swordsman who protected Little Sword Queen like a guard.

    They said when he descended the mountain he used his outstanding martial arts to help common people. His fame was widespread.

    From Yunnan where Diancang Mountain was located all the way to Sichuan here. All those deeds were done alongside Little Sword Queen.

    “Senior Sister. Shall we return now? It seems we’ve given sufficient advice.”

    Xie Dao-ling didn’t bother lowering his voice.

    He acknowledged they had unintentionally committed rudeness. But his conduct toward his senior sister was separate.

    ‘Lightning Genius Jeong Yeon-shin?’

    The boy’s appearance was quite strange. A black robe with uneven sleeve lengths and careless speech and conduct… Though Desolate Fortress’  Lightning Genius’s fame was spreading throughout the murim, he thought one shouldn’t be so rude to Senior Sister Qu Su-yu who had long since mastered swordsmanship reaching the realm of mastery and traveled performing heroic deeds.

    But he couldn’t argue.

    Though lacking purple-ranks, their forces were powerful.

    There were over ten blue-rank masters guarding the war carriages. It was a lineup comparable to one of the seventeen Divine Sword Squads.

    Rumors also spread that Desolate Fortress’s young master had defeated supreme masters from the Ten Perfections Sect and Pure Demon Alliance in succession.

    It was hard to dismiss as mere rumors, as countless spectators had witnessed the battle on Kuizhou’s main road.

    They were clearly outmatched in martial power.

    Having committed rudeness first, they had no justification either.

    Xie Dao-ling could only vent his frustration by withdrawing from this place.

    “Hmm… Should we?”

    Little Sword Queen Qu Su-yu tilted her head slightly.

    Her jet black hair shifted to the side, as if demonstrating her free nature.

    Jeong Yeon-shin stared blankly at this unusual Diancang swordsman.

    “You’re leaving?”

    He muttered Xie Dao-ling’s words absentmindedly.

    Perhaps taking the boy’s muttering as a question directed at her? Qu Su-yu’s lips drew a bright smile.

    “It seems that’s the most comfortable option for both sides.”

    “You’ll examine our situation, then return…?”

    Sharp intent dwelled in Jeong Yeon-shin’s words and conduct. Simply avoiding making enemies wasn’t everything.

    They had already somewhat guessed Ma Yeon-jeok’s condition.

    They couldn’t carelessly let this slide just because they were Nine Sects disciples – the matter was far too serious.

    Suddenly.

    “Capture them.”

    The boy in the black robe commanded.

    WHOOSH!

    In that instant a fireball plunged down from the sky.

    A figure surrounded by massive flames charged straight toward Xie Dao-ling’s face.

    While the air distorted colorlessly, Lazy Flame Dragon wrapped in the Scorching Divine Meridian’s Heat Yang True Qi smiled while chewing opium.

    “Don’t kill them, right? The temporary commander’s subordinates usually…”

    “I said capture them.”

    CLANG!

    Lazy Flame Dragon’s fist fell on Xie Dao-ling’s half-drawn Narrow Peak Sword.

    As impact waves burst with heat, the thin blade shattered to pieces.

    At the same time, Lazy Flame Dragon who had grabbed Xie Dao-ling’s nape whispered languidly.

    “Where do you think you’re going after randomly probing a major faction’s important matters? If we reverse the situation, would you have let us go peacefully if the Diancang Sect Leader was in there?”

    “Huk…!”

    “How dare a low-rank act up.”

    Lazy Flame Dragon smiled faintly and injected Heat Yang True Qi into the acupoint on the back of Xie Dao-ling’s neck.

    In that moment the paralyzed Xie Dao-ling stared at him with wide eyes. Lazy Flame Dragon’s smile deepened.

    “Lower your eyes, trash.”

    It was the conduct of the Hwangbo young master.

    On the opposite side stood Namgung Hwa-shin. He had his Desolate sword pointed at the chin of another woman from Little Sword Queen’s group.

    It was Diancang’s Sword Dancer, the martial sister of the Diancang group.

    White Qilin’s Heaven Crossing Unfettered Sword Technique was so profound that Diancang Sword Dancer couldn’t handle even one move.

    It wasn’t just Jeong Yeon-shin who had grown. Lazy Flame Dragon and Namgung Hwa-shin were also becoming endlessly stronger.

    Their martial prowess and the refinement of their techniques were evident.

    Being able to subdue Nine Sects disciples in an instant meant they were particularly powerful even among blue-ranks.

    “How brutal.”

    Hyeon Won-chang muttered while turning his gaze to the side.

    The temporary commander, Jeong Yeon-shin was facing Little Sword Queen. It was a strange relationship.

    They clearly couldn’t be called enemies, but they couldn’t simply let them go either.

    In this moment the boy was spinning the luminous wheel in his heart.

    He emitted the auspicious energy of the Luminous Wheel That Transcends Law throughout his body, completely blocking the earlier energy fluctuations.

    WHOOSH!

    Extremely dense waves of energy spread out. They directly pressured Little Sword Queen before him.

    To prevent her from attacking Lazy Flame Dragon or Namgung Hwa-shin.

    “You are…”

    Little Sword Queen Qu Su-yu’s gentle eyes slowly rose.

    Her attention that had been focused on the war carriages carrying the purple-rank masters shifted entirely to the boy.

    “You can’t leave.”

    Jeong Yeon-shin said calmly.

    FLUTTER!

    He brushed off the black hem of his right sleeve, which had been fluttering in the energy waves.

    He thought of his uncle who hadn’t sent any sound transmissions even as the confrontation neared its breaking point.

    This return journey was the boy’s test.

    It was a practical journey to reach the position of commander in one go.

    A journey watched and evaluated by the former Divine Sword Group Leader, Elder Council Leader, and Radiant Demon Wing Leader.

    How would he lead the group as commander of a Desolate Fortress military force?

    Could he fully display his innate martial arts while carrying such an important mission?

    Would he prove capabilities befitting a Desolate Fortress black-rank commander by properly utilizing his subordinates?

    ‘They said a commander gathering would be held when we return to the main fortress.’

    He heard the black rank was different.

    Desolate Fortress black.

    They even had the authority, in secret collaboration with the royal family, to strip corrupt officials of their positions.

    There was much to show. He had to prove that he was capable of fully commanding an elite group of masters.

    The corners of Little Sword Queen’s mouth rose gently. It was a smile unsuited to the situation.
